Individual Herbs used in NOTWeeds' Blends - Actions and Properties


Alfalfa (medicago sativa) – alkalizing, diuretic, rich in nutrients ( Vit. A, K and some of the B group; minerals s.a. Iron, magnesium, potassium, zince, calcium, folate.


Damiana (turnera diffusa) – aphorodisiac, uplifting, popular smoking herb


Dandelion Leaf (Taraxacum officinale ) - rich in Vitamins A, B1, B2, C, E ; minerals s.a. calcium, chromium, iron, magnesium, manganese, phosphorus, potassium, sodium, selenium, silicon, zinc.

Stimulates digestion and elimination as well as providing valuable nutrients to the body.


Echinacea (echinacea purpurea ) - well known immune stimulant, anti-viral, anti-bacterial, commonly used in commercially available infection prevention or -fighting preparations.


Horny Goat Weed (epimedium) – chinese herb used to boost libido and assist with erectile dysfunction


Kola Nut (cola) - used to combat mental fatigue, stimulates the nervous system, appetite suppressant, fat burning properties (contains caffeine)


Ladies Mantle (alchemilla vulgaris) - used to reduce uterine bleeding, ease menstrual cramps, and regulate the menstrual cycle, also useful for treating diarrhoea.


Mullein (Verbascum thapsus) – nutritional herb that is rich in Vit A, B-complex, D, magnesium, potassium, sulphur, iron. Commonly used to treat respiratory infections (internal – as a tea), skin problems (externally). This herb also has a long history as a smoking herb and has been known to assist with respiratory conditions and hay-fever.


Oat Straw (avena sativa) – highly nutritive herb, support the nervous system, anti – depressive, can assist with quitting smoking, helps build healthy nails, hair and bones.


Passionflower (passiflora incarnata ) - valuable herb that has sedative properties, assists with finding restful sleep, anxiety, panic attacks, menstrual cramps, bladder spasms and headache.


Peppermint (mentha piperita) – well known herb that has widespread application for gastric upsets. Exceptionally helpful in relieving nausea, colic, griping and wind. By soothing an irritated lining and muscles of the colon, it helps diarrhoea and relieves a spastic colon which is often the cause of constipation.

Skullcap (Scutellaria lateriflora) - this herb is most useful for treating anxiety, depression, insomnia, and nervous headaches. It is often used in smoking blends for it superb relaxing qualities.


St Johns Wort (Hypericum perforatum) – well known herb widely available in herbal preparations to treat depression. This herb is very useful in treating other conditions relating to the nervous system, s.a. Sciatica due to its pain relieving effect. Also very useful in the prevention of viral illnesses and treatment for herpes infections.
